    It means that you are a bisexual/pansexual with NO gender preference. You like both men and women equally.

    If you are bi/pan and you prefer men on the other hand, you are kinsey 2. If you are bi and prefer women, you are kinsey 4. If you are gay and can make exceptions for men, you are kinsey 5 (or kinsey 1 if you are straight and can make exceptions), and if you are completely gay with no exceptions ever, you are 6 (or 0 if 100% straight).
